A CHARACTERISTIC OCCURRENCE OF EARTHQUAKE SWAMS AT THE ASO CALDERA-RIM

open access: yesA CHARACTERISTIC OCCURRENCE OF EARTHQUAKE SWAMS AT THE ASO CALDERA-RIM
Since the big explosion of October, 1965, at the Volcano Aso, the red-hot bottom in the 1st crater has been observed almost continuously during these several years. At the end of July, 1971, a small pit of 10 m in diameter opened at the bottom of crater and volcanic ash has been ejected intermittently from October, 1971, until now.
